2015-02-11 48 views
7

我已经从Pygame网站下载pygame-1.9.1release.tar.gz。我提取并安装了它,它在终端(Ubuntu)中的命令行Python解释器中工作正常。但是我想为一些IDE安装它,比如PyCharm。我该怎么做?在PyCharm IDE中添加pygame模块

+1

你是什么意思*“为某些IDE安装它”*?您的PyCharm项目是否使用可以访问'pygame'的解释器(请参阅https://www.jetbrains.com/pycharm/quickstart/configuring_interpreter.html)?它是否使用与命令行相同的命令行(使用'which python'查找)? – jonrsharpe 2015-02-11 12:04:05

+0

解释器配置后得到它。感谢您的建议。但它仍然不适用于IDLE(使用python2.7),因为它有它自己的解释器。 – 2015-02-11 12:28:03

+0

如果你想用特定的解释器运行IDLE,在终端中使用'/ path/to/python -m idlelib' – jonrsharpe 2015-02-11 12:29:37

回答

8

那么,你不必在这里下载PyCharm。你可能知道它是如何检查你的代码的。通过翻译!你不需要使用复杂的命令行或类似的东西。你需要的是:

  • 下载 pygame的包括

  • 打开PyCharm IDE(请确保它是最新的)

  • 转到File

  • 适当的解释
  • 新闻Settings(或Ctrl + Alt + S)

  • 双击上看起来像选项Project: Name_of_Project

  • 点击Project Interpreter

  • 选择要使用包括 pygame的一个模块

  • 保存解释你的选项

你准备好了!这里是一个备用(我从来没有这样做,请尝试测试它)

  • 在同一文件夹添加pygame的为您PyCharm文件(你PyCharm的东西总是在 在一个特定的文件放在通过安装/升级) 请考虑把你的PyCharm的东西放在一个文件夹中,以方便访问。

我希望这可以帮助你!

1

我只是想通了!

  1. .whl文件中C:\Program Files\Anaconda3
  2. 虽然该文件夹中,点击浏览器窗口的左上角的蓝色文件选项卡上(假设你使用的是Windows)上
  3. 点击打开Windows PowerShell中以管理员身份
  4. 写或只是复制和粘贴:py -m pip install pygame
  5. 应该开始安装
  6. 完成!

我希望它适合你。我知道它为我做了。

0

如果您正在使用PyCharm和您是Windows 10的机器上使用如下指令:

  1. 单击Windows的开始菜单上,然后键入CMD 点击命令提示符图标。

  2. 使用命令pushd导航到您应该位于C:\驱动器上的用户文件夹中的PyCharm项目。例如:C:\ Users \ username \ PycharmProjects \ project name \ venv \ Scripts

    (如果您不确定转到PyCharm中的设置并导航到Python解释器设置,这应该会显示您的项目正在使用的解释器的文件路径感谢Anthony Pham提供的导航到解释器的说明设置

    提示:使用复制和在命令提示符下粘贴的文件路径粘贴。

  3. 使用命令pip install pygame并且pip程序将为您处理其余的问题。

  4. 重新启动您Pycharm,你现在应该能够导入pygame的

希望这有助于。我有一段时间试图找到正确的方法来安装它,所以希望这可以帮助未来的人。

2

对于PyCharm 2017年做到以下几点:

  • 文件 - 设置
  • 您的项目名称
  • 选择项目解释
  • 单击窗口右侧的绿色+按钮双击
  • 在搜索窗口中键入Pygame的
  • 点击安装包。

不是我说上面的答案是行不通的,但是对于一个新手来说,做命令行的魔法可能会令人沮丧。